До грешке 1045 долази због забрањеног приступа бази података
Садржај чланка:
- 1 Узроци приступа су одбијени за корисничку грешку роот @ лоцалхост
- 2 Како да поправите грешку 1045 у МиСКЛ-у
Забрањени су узроци приступа због грешке роот-а @ лоцалхост корисника
Да бисте приступили МиСКЛ-у, три се морају подударати параметри који описују корисника базе података – име, име и лозинка аутомобила. Ако постоје разлике, приступ ће бити одбијен Најједноставнији узрок проблема је нетачан унос лозинке. Поред тога, може проузроковати грешку. погрешна синтакса.
У МиСКЛ систему не постоји једноставна зависност од корисничког имена – лозинка, име хоста игра важну улогу у приступу бази података. Може бити у облику ИП адресе, имена домена, кључне речи (нпр. лоцалхост) или лик који комбинује више машина у група (на пример,% – било који домаћин осим локалног).
Грешка има кључ (Употреба лозинке: НЕ) приликом уласка у базу података прегледач
Најчешће грешке приликом приступа бази података:
- При додељивању права новом кориснику адреса није наведена машина са којом се може повезати. У овом случају он аутоматски ће бити дозвољено да користи базу података са било ког хостова осим лоцал, а када покушате да се повежете са лоцалхост, долази до грешке приступ.
- Нетачно постављени наводници. Ако приликом стварања корисник напиши ‘корисничко име @ лоцалхост, то ће то значити корисничко име @ лоцалхост може да се повеже са било које машине осим локално, а не да се корисничко име може повезати са рачунара лоцалхост. Корисничко име и име машине морају имати свој пар наводници.
- Употреба лозинке ако је нема у бази података.
Зависно од тога који је начин повезивања са базом података Приступ је одбијен за кориснички ‘роот @ лоцалхост (Коришћење лозинка: ДА или НЕ), користе се различите методе решења проблеми.
Како поправити грешку 1045 у МиСКЛ-у
Ако је грешка одбијена за приступ кориснику ‘роот @ лоцалхост (Коришћење лозинка: ДА и НЕ) се појављује са Употреба лозинке: ДА, Проблем је у томе што је лозинка унета погрешно. Погледајте ово могуће је, отварајући табелу мискл.усер у којој су подаци о сви корисници.
Табела мискл.усер чува податке за пријаву корисника
Процедура је следећа:
- Отворите табелу корисника.
- Проверите да ли роот корисник постоји са хостхост-ом лоцалхост. Ако постоји, погледајте поље “лозинка”. Ако је празно, идите на У базу података се може унијети без лозинке. Ако има нечега тамо, онда и ти унесите погрешну лозинку.
- Промените лозинку командом СЕТ ПАССВОРД.
- Ако нема роот корисника, креирајте га, поставите лозинку и дајте му права.
Након тога можете ући у базу података. Ако не промените податке испада да би требало да користите параметар –скип-грант-табле, која надјачава сва подешавања дозвола.
Линије за промену у конфигурацијској датотеци
Ако се грешка појави уз тастер (Користећи лозинку: НЕ), требате урадите следећу измену датотеке цонфиг.инц.пхп, наводећи је у њој тачни подаци. Ако се проблем појави приликом инсталирања МиСКЛ-а, требате обрисати базе података старе верзије програма или променити лозинку за приступ њима помоћу режима -скип-грант табле.
Дакле, грешка је Приступ одбијен за корисников ‘роот @ лоцалхост (Употреба лозинке: ДА или НЕ) дешава се када се лозинка не подудара и корисничко име и лако се поправља заменом података за улаз.